Rye's Story

Once upon a chilly day, a kind park ranger stumbled upon three tiny kittens (Ciabatta, Rye, and Pumpernickel) huddled together — scared, hungry, and waiting for a miracle. Fast forward a few months, and look at them now! <br/><br/>Rye and her sister Pumpernickel and her brother Ciabatta are about 6 months old. They’ve been spayed/neutered, microchipped, and tested negative for FIV/FeLV — all ready for their forever homes. They’re currently being spoiled (just a little!) in a loving foster home in the Columbus area, where they’ve proven to be affectionate, playful, and full of personality.<br/><br/>These kittens are the perfect mix of cozy and curious — the kind of companions who’ll keep you laughing during the day and purring beside you at night.<br/><br/>If you’re located in Ohio, and you’re interested in adopting Rye, submit an application online - https://www.forgotten4paws.com/adopt-adoptform. Applicants can also request to foster-to-adopt (meaning a cat can be fostered on a trial basis before making a decision to adopt). Note that a verifiable vet history is required, and an application must be submitted prior to arranging a meeting. Email contactusforgotten4paws@yahoo.com with any questions.

Forgotten 4 Paws's Adoption Policy
Matching responsible pet guardians with Forgotten 4-Paws' cats is our primary goal. We carefully interview potential adopters because we want to make sure the right match is made! Our Forgotten 4-Paws 'interviewers' do a great job of matchmaking. We work hard to fit your adoption criteria with the pets we have up for adoption. We want the adoption to be successful for both you and the cat or dog! Too often pets end up in shelters because they were never a good match for their homes in the first place. At Forgotten 4-Paws, we look for people who intend to provide a home for the life of the pet and understand what that requires. ADOPTION PROCESS Start by completing an application. Online adoption applications are available at www.Forgotten4Paws.org. Please email any questions contactusforgotten4paws@yahoo.com. Please note that submitting an application does not guarantee that a cat or kitten will be placed with you. Once you submit your application, a Forgotten 4-Paws volunteer will contact you for an interview and to talk about the specific pet(s) you expressed interest in. After the interview process, we will set up a time for you to meet the cat / kitten to make sure a successful match has been made. Typically, this will be at your home. If approved, the volunteer will make arrangements for your new feline to join your family. The adoption fees are $85.00 for one cat/kitten or $150 for two cats/kittens.
